LAPACK (Linear Algebra PACKage) is a standard library for numerical
linear algebra. LAPACK provides routines for solving systems of
simultaneous linear equations, least-squares solutions of linear
systems of equations, eigenvalue problems, and singular value
problems. Associated matrix factorizations (LU, Cholesky, QR, SVD,
Schur, and generalized Schur) and related computations (i.e.,
reordering of Schur factorizations and estimating condition numbers)
are also included. LAPACK can handle dense and banded matrices, but
not general sparse matrices. Similar functionality is provided for
real and complex matrices in both single and double precision. LAPACK
is coded in Fortran90 and built with gcc.
